Senjan () is a neighborhood in the city of Arak in the Central District of Arak County, Markazi province, Iran. As a city, it served as the administrative center for Sedeh Rural District until its capital was transferred to the village of Zamen Jan.

==Demographics== ===Population=== At the time of the 2006 National Census, Senjan's population was 10,592 in 2,897 households, when it was a city in the Central District. The following census in 2011 counted 12,249 people in 3,730 households.
